diff --git a/app.py b/app.py index d85a792..b0d8aee 100644 --- a/app.py +++ b/app.py @@ -122,7 +122,7 @@ def se_puede_extraer(): release_db_connection(conn) # Liberar la conexión -def extract(username: str, password: str): +def extract(driver, username: str, password: str): url_credentials = f'https://{username}:{password}@sgu.ulsa.edu.mx/psulsa/alumnos/consultainformacionalumnos/consultainformacion.aspx' url = 'https://sgu.ulsa.edu.mx/psulsa/alumnos/consultainformacionalumnos/consultainformacion.aspx' username_integer = int(username[2:]) @@ -182,7 +182,7 @@ def main(): password = request.form.get('password') se_puede = se_puede_extraer() if se_puede: - query = extract(username, password) + query = extract(driver, username, password) return jsonify({"message": "Data extracted successfully", "en-fecha": se_puede}) finally: if driver is not None: